API Drill Bit Structure

  • Thread Connections (API): These standardized threads on the bit shank ensure a secure, compatible fit with the drill string, allowing efficient power and fluid transmission.

  • Leg: The leg is the main body that extends from the connection, housing the bearings and supporting the cones. It’s built to withstand drilling forces.

  • Nozzle: Strategically placed openings that jet drilling fluid to cool the bit, lubricate bearings, and clear cuttings from the bottom of the hole.

  • Shirttail: The protective skirt covering the bearing assembly from abrasive cuttings. It shields internal components, extending bit life.

  • Cone: Three rotating conical structures, each with cutting elements, that roll and interact with the rock to break it.

  • Gauge Rows: Outermost cutting elements on the cones. They maintain the precise diameter of the borehole, crucial for proper well construction.

  • Inner Rows: Cutting elements closer to the bit’s center. They break up the core of the rock, complementing the gauge rows for full-face removal.

  • Gauge Diameter (API): The maximum outer diameter of the bit, dictating the size of the drilled hole, adhering to API sizing standards.

Cutting Structure Optimization:

We meticulously design the cutting structure of our API drill bits to match the specific rock formation you’ll encounter. This involves selecting the optimal type, size, and arrangement of cutting elements—whether it’s milled teeth for softer formations or various Tungsten Carbide Inserts (TCI) for harder rock—to achieve the most efficient rock destruction and maximize penetration rates.

Bearing and Seal System Selection:

We offer a range of advanced bearing and seal systems, allowing us to customize for expected rotational speeds, weight-on-bit (WOB), and drilling fluid properties. Our goal is to ensure durability and reliability under challenging downhole conditions, extending the bit’s operational life and preventing premature failure, which is critical for minimizing downtime.

Hydraulic Configuration Design:

We precisely engineer the hydraulic system, including nozzle size, number, and placement, to optimize fluid flow and cuttings removal. This customization ensures effective bottom-hole cleaning and prevents bit balling, especially in sticky or soft formations. Proper hydraulic design is crucial for maintaining high ROP and preventing unnecessary wear on the cutting structure.

Gauge Protection and Stabilization:

We provide various gauge protection options, such as hardfacing, TCI inserts, and diamond-enhanced elements, to maintain the desired hole diameter throughout the drilling process. This customization helps to prevent premature gauge wear and ensures hole quality, which is vital for subsequent casing and completion operations, reducing the risk of costly reaming or deviation issues.

what is API?

API stands for the American Petroleum Institute. It’s the largest U.S. trade association representing the oil and natural gas industry.

 API develops and maintains over 700 industry standards and recommended practices, covering nearly every segment of the oil and gas industry, from drilling and production to refining and environmental protection. These standards are widely adopted globally and help ensure safety, efficiency, and environmental protection across the industry. When we refer to “API drill bits,” it means the drill bits are manufactured according to these established API standards, ensuring quality and interchangeability.

what is a API drill bit?

An API drill bit refers to a drilling tool manufactured and tested according to the rigorous standards set forth by the American Petroleum Institute. These standards cover various aspects of drill bit design, manufacturing, materials, and performance specifications, ensuring a high level of quality, interchangeability, and reliability across the global oil and gas industry. 

By adhering to API specifications, manufacturers provide bits that are compatible with standardized drilling equipment and meet recognized industry benchmarks for safety and efficiency in diverse drilling operations.

 The significance of an API drill bit lies in its assurance of quality and performance consistency. When a drill bit is API certified, it means it has undergone strict manufacturing processes and quality control checks that align with the institute’s guidelines. 
This includes specifications for components like the cutting structure (milled tooth or TCI), bearing systems, hydraulics, and connection threads. This standardization helps drilling operators confidently select bits that will perform predictably in various geological conditions, optimize drilling efficiency, and reduce the risks associated with equipment failure in challenging downhole environments.
